Output 702b59f38357232a8c74f5220933674fad8620884dbdb918e9c5c59c36e30f20:0

value
20416679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5b9a04d3f48c7154a74fafec512932900a4526e OP_EQUAL
address
3Ndh31JBfXXbpbAtn3kL62xuM8VngMxBhP
transaction
702b59f38357232a8c74f5220933674fad8620884dbdb918e9c5c59c36e30f20
spent
true